Jewellery Bubble, warm (2020), Mariko Kusumoto

The ethereal delicacy of Mariko Kusumoto’s designs are a triumph of skill and craftsmanship. The artist specialises in creating jewellery and objects out of polyester fibres, inspired by motifs of marine life, flowers and the everyday. The result is somewhat magical and uplifting: ‘My work reflects various, observable phenomena that stimulate my mind and senses. I “reorganize” them into a new presentation that can be described as surreal, amusing, graceful, or unexpected,’ she describes. Shown as part of Kusumoto’s fittingly titled show ‘Natural Grace’ at Micheko Galerie in Munich, ‘Bubble, warm’ encapsulates the lightness of beauty that pervades her work.
